DocLint 3.4.1 — changelog. Added rule DL-412 flagging orphaned anchors. Heading-case checker now respects the Marwick style guide exceptions file. Fixed false positives on fenced code blocks inside admonitions. Dropped support for the legacy Quillport config format; run the migrate subcommand once. CI now fails on warnings in the handbook repo only. New team members: read the rules index before filing exemptions. Questions go to the maintainer named below.

account owner for tawef-yadug: Jorius Normir Silath

== Drone return: SV-9 "Pelliq" ==

The survey drone is headed back to Marwood Avionics for its annual servicing. Records team: log the airframe hours from the green booklet before it leaves, and keep a scan of the service request. Brant's courier picks it up Tuesday. The depot will only accept it against this phrase:

courier memo of yawep-yafog: the pramir ulaix courier leaves the ulavan aldix frair zorok oliiel joreth rusdor fenvan ledger at gate 1305 under passcode 514738

## Releases

Starting with v2.4, the Fernwick API ships the batched-loader fix for the infamous GraphQL N+1 on `orders → lineItems`. Don't revert the dataloader wiring — query counts will explode again. Tag releases from `main`, run the perf smoke test, and sign the tarball before publishing. The release signing key you'll need is right here.

deploy key for kahof-tadup: bky4_rRMZ

**First-aid room — night access**

Location: Level 1, west corridor, Danbrook Building. Unlocked 08:00–18:00; locked overnight. Night shift: log any use in the book on the shelf inside. Restock requests go to the facilities inbox. Defibrillator is in the wall cabinet outside the room, not inside. For overnight entry, use the keypad code below.

door code, tahop-fahap: bdg-JZCXMY-37375484

**Q: A customer says Shrinkwright fails on folders with more than 10,000 images. What do we tell them?**

A: This is a known limitation in versions before 3.2; the batch planner exhausts file handles. Ask them to upgrade, or split the job with the --chunk flag. Full troubleshooting steps are documented here.

wiki page, tahaf-tajog: https://jira.ordindyn.corp/pipeline